Renting vs. Buying a House: Pros and Cons

Nashville is one of the most desirable places to live in the U.S. People living in Middle Tennessee enjoy a high quality of life, vibrant communities, and year-round entertainment. Of course, the city’s reputation comes at a cost. Nashville is one of the country’s highest-priced rental markets, and that momentum shows few signs of slowing.

Many people attempt to wait out the housing market by renting, but that strategy may not be in your best interest in the Nashville region. This guide is for you if you are considering whether to rent or buy a house.

Renting vs. Buying

Putting down roots through homeownership is a quintessential part of the American dream. Along with financial benefits such as wealth-building and tax deductions, owning a house brings consistency and a sense of belonging.

Renting can be unpredictable. Your rent payment may go up without warning, straining your household budget. You are also reliant on your landlord to handle any problems that arise. While it might not cost you anything extra to deal with a pest infestation in your apartment, you may end up waiting weeks for the landlord to send an exterminator.

Once you own a home, you are no longer accountable to a landlord. You’re free to decide how to decorate your interior and exterior to reflect your unique style. You can also make improvements and upgrades to increase your home’s property value if you decide to put it on the market. While a home is perhaps the largest purchase you’ll ever make, you will have an asset that appreciates over time instead of paying rent every month.

Should You Rent, or Buy?

Those looking to start or add to their family look to buy homes to put down roots. Once you find a neighborhood and school district you like, you’ll naturally want to become part of the community. You don’t want the upheaval of a surprise rent increase or a broken lease to disrupt your sense of stability.

Still, not everyone is in a good position to buy a home. It requires a significant upfront investment, and also means committing to the maintenance costs that come with it. Ultimately, the decision to rent vs. buy involves many financial and emotional considerations. You need to weigh the potential advantages, disadvantages, and costs of each based on your income and lifestyle.
